PELLAEA pectiniformis Bak. [family ADIANTACEAE]
Flora of Tropical East Africa, page 1, (2002) Author: BERNARD VERDCOURT
Royal Botanic Gardens, Kew (K)
Reference Sources
DISTR. T 1 (fide Schippers), 4–6 (fide Peter) 7, 8
Rhizome shortly creeping with linear-lanceolate chestnut scales 3–5 mm long. Fronds closely spaced or appearing ± tufted, few to ± 10, 25–50 cm tall; stipe dark purplish brown, 7–25 cm long, appressed pubescent and with very narrow pale brown scales; lamina narrowly oblong to narrowly oblong-oblanceolate, 14–30 cm long, 3–9 cm wide, simply pinnate; pinnae coriaceous, 25–45 on each side of rhachis, linear to linear-oblong, 1.2–5 cm long, 1–6 mm wide, ± rounded at apex, cordate at the base, glabrous above, hairy on midrib beneath; rhachis with hairs and scales similar to the stipe; stalks blackish, articulated at apex, hairy; veins free, obscure. Sori and indusium continuous.
Pellaea pectiniformis Bak. [family ADIANTACEAE]
FZ, Vol 0, Part 0, page 98, (1970) Author: E. A. C. L. E. Schelpe
Royal Botanic Gardens, Kew (K)
Reference Sources
Rhizome c. 5 mm. in diam., short, creeping, with tufted fronds and with brown subentire narrowly lanceolate attenuate rhizome-scales up to 3 mm. long. Stipe atrocastaneous, up to 25 cm. long, terete, thinly pubescent with short appressed hairs and a few pale subulate scales, becoming glabrous with age. Frond erect, thinly coriaceous. Lamina up to 30 x 9 cm., very narrowly to narrowly oblong in outline, simply pinnate (the lowest pinnae undivided); pinnae petiolulate, up to 5 x 0.15 cm., very narrowly linear, obtuse, with a cordate base articulated at the apex of a short atrocastaneous petiolule; ventral surface glabrous, dorsal surface glabrous except for pale flexuous hairs along the costa; rhachis terete, atrocastaneous, persistently thinly villous with hairs and very narrow pale-brown scales. Sori in a continuous line at maturity; indusium continuous, erose, membranous.
Pellaea pectiniformis Baker [family PTERIDACEAE]
Swaziland Ferns and Fern Allies, (2003) Author: J.P. Roux
South African National Biodiversity Institute, Compton Herbarium, Cape Town (SAM)
Reference Sources
Distribution: Rare in Swaziland and confined to the south-western part of the country, occurring at an altitude of ±1 000 m. Widespread in west central tropical Africa, east and south tropical Africa, southern Africa, and the western Indian Ocean region.
Plants terrestrial or epilithic. Rhizome short-decumbent, to 30 mm long, to 5 mm in diameter, set with roots, closely spaced persistent stipe bases and scales, scales thinly crustaceous, ferrugineus, adnate, linear to subulate, irregularly and shallowly dentate, apex terminates in a small thin-walled cell or a short subulate cell, to 6 mm long, to 0.5 mm wide. Fronds crowded, erect, to 435 mm long, to 7 per plant; stipe rigid, atrocastaneus, terete, to 150 mm long, to 2 mm in diameter, initially densely scaled, scales chartaceus, stramineous to ferrugineus, sessile, filiform to subulate, entire, apex terminates in a small thin-walled cell or a short subulate cell, to 5 mm long, to 0.3 mm wide; lamina oblong-acute, 1-pinnate, to 300 mm long, to 90 mm wide, with up to 52 pinna pairs; rachis atrocastaneus, terete, initially closely set with hairs and scales similar to those on the stipe; pinnae petiolate, petiole to 2 mm long, closely set with hairs and scales similar to those on rachis, opposite to alternate, pectinate, generally more widely spaced basally, coriaceus, linear, entire, cordate to inaequilaterally cordate, acute, to 44 mm long, to 3 mm wide, glabrous adaxially, abaxially with filiform scales and pluricellular, uniseriate hairs along costa, to 2 mm long, articulated; costa adaxially sulcate. Venation obscure, forked, free, branches terminate near the margin. Sori forms a continuous line along a marginal vascular commissure; receptacle with simple, pluricellular, uniseriate hairs terminating in an orange oblong to clavate cell, to 0.5 mm long; sporangium long-stalked, stalk simple, 3-seriate below capsule, capsule globose to obovate in lateral view, with (14-)14(-16) indurated annulus cells, epistomium (4-)4(-6)-celled, hypostomium (4-)4(-6)-celled, stomium with 4 narrow cells with conspicuously thickened walls; indusium continuous, near-marginal, chartaceus, entire, to 0.4 mm wide. Spores 32 per sporangium, brown, smooth-granulose, monolete, elliptic, (66-)68(-72) x (44-)45.33(-48) (m, or tetrahedral-globose, trilete, (50-)54(-64) (m. Figure 19E & F.
PELLAEA sp. [family ADIANTACEAE]
Flora of Tropical East Africa, page 1, (2002) Author: BERNARD VERDCOURT
Royal Botanic Gardens, Kew (K)
Reference Sources
DISTR. T 4 not known elsewhere
Rhizome very shortly creeping, with very narrowly lanceolate somewhat curved scales 3–4 mm long, either with dark centre and paler margins or entirely pale, ± longitudinally ribbed; roots with dark shiny setiform hairs. Fronds 3 remaining but probably up to 7, tufted, 13–16 cm tall; stipes relatively broad, ± 2.5 mm in diameter, dark brown, covered with dense mostly appressed upwardly directed brown hairs; rhachis similar; lamina pale green, oblong, 4–7 cm long, 4.5–6 cm wide, simply pinnate; pinnae in 8–10 pairs, oblong-lanceolate, 1.8–3.5 cm long, 4–7.5 mm wide, separated from each other by 2–5(–8) mm, narrowed to a subacute or ± rounded apex, distinctly cordate at base, with pale hairs having brown joints scattered on the under surface and also a few above on the midrib; basal part of midrib dark beneath for 5–6 mm and stalklets 1–2 mm long, both hairy like the rhachis; venation entirely free but not visible without strong transmitted light. Sori in marginal line and with a continuous pale membranous reflexed indusium.
